    Responsibilities:

    + Perform clinical and diagnostic echocardiograms and pediatric and adult congenital cardiac patient’s inpatient, outpatient and procedural settings and for assisting in other areas of the Pediatric Non-Invasive Lab.

    + Perform other duties as assigned.

    Requirements:

    + Required - BLS (Basic Life Support)

    + Required - RDCS (Sonography) - within 1 year; Or - RCS (Sonography) - within 1 year.

    + Required - Technical; Preferred - Associates - Related Field

    + Required 6 months of Echocardiology experience

    + Required 6 months of Pediatric experience

    + **Travel required to Tampa and Sarasota when needed**

    Highly Preferred skills:

    + Ability to document and record cardiac pathology in order for the physician to render a diagnosis

    + Ability to work independently as a care team member

    + Professional interaction with team members

    + Effective communication skills, detailed oriented and ability to adapt to unforeseen circumstances

    + Ability to recognize a variety of different types of cardiac defects and demonstrate the ability to tailor the exam based on the defect and patient cooperation
